Abstract
We show that the (1,0) tensor and hypermultiplet supersymmetry variations can be uplifted to loop space. Upon dimensional reduction we make contact with abelian five-dimensional super Yang-Mills, which has a nonabelian generalization that we subsequently uplift back to loop space where we conjecture a nonabelian generalization of the (1,0) supersymmetry variations and demonstrate their on-shell closure.
